That had actually not been the situation, prior to the First Globe War, when most of residential automobile manufacturers immediately renewed their dealership franchises at the end of the calendar year. Automatic revival paid for a certain level of company safety and security especially for reduced volume representatives. Franchise revival guarantees like that had all yet vanished by 1925 as vehicle makers routinely ended their least lucrative outlets.Such unsympathetic treatments only softened after the Second World War when some residential automakers started to expand the length of franchise business contracts from one to five years. Carmakers might have still reserved the right to terminate agreements at will; nevertheless, several franchise contracts, beginning in the 1950s, consisted of a new arrangement intended straight at an additional equally troublesome problem namely securing car dealership sequence.

Cars and truck dealers provide a series of solutions associated to the trading of cars and trucks. One of their major features is to serve as intermediaries (or intermediaries) between car suppliers and clients, buying lorries straight from the manufacturer and after that offering them to customers at a markup. In enhancement, they frequently supply financing alternatives for purchasers and will aid with the trade-in or sale of a customer's old lorry.
